It is set in an English language school for foreigners in the 1960s and is as quintessentially English as Danny Boyle’s opening ceremony was: a humourous but ultimately moving account of two years in the lives of seven teachers.
At the heart of the group is St. John Quartermaine (Rowan Atkinson) – kind, pleasant and agreeable, but utterly hopeless as a teacher. An almost permanent feature in the staff room, he’s always available to listen to the problems of his self-obsessed colleagues. But when a new Principal is appointed, Quartermaine’s future looks precarious…
